Fishing
The waters of Tampa Bay, Anna Maria Sound, The Manatee river, Tierra Ceia Bay, and the gulf beaches offer a wide variety of species that we target, ranging from Snook to Snapper, and everything in between. There is a variety of migratory species that fluctuate throughout the local waters seasonally. What they target varies depending on the season.  Clients can keep their legal catches and they will be cleaned and packaged at the end of the trip.  Ask the Captain about several dining establishments that would be happy to cook you catch!

Nearshore fishing with the Captain takes you just a few miles off the coast, where the waters of the Gulf of Mexico teem with a variety of prized species. These trips are perfect for anglers who want the excitement of offshore fishing without venturing too far from shore. The nearshore waters around Anna Maria Island are rich in marine life, providing ample opportunities to catch a diverse range of fish, including Kingfish, Cobia, Grouper, Snapper, and more.

About Your Tarpon Fishing Adventure

These fish are by far, are his favorite species to target. Typically, the spring migration starts the first week of May and fizzles out towards the end of June. He frequently schedules trips according to the moon phase. The very early morning and late in the evening can be extremely productive. So, if you’re planning on targeting these acrobatic high-flyers, please be flexible. When targeting Tarpon, that is all you will target. Tarpon will range from 40-200 pounds and you should be prepared for the fight of lifetime!  Don’t forget your cameras and video equipment.
